About Evaro, Montana

Evaro rests in the embrace of Montana's wide western valleys, where the sky seems to stretch to an impossible, cerulean horizon. It lies 12.0 miles north-north-west of Missoula, MT (from Missoula, MT: bearing 337°T), and is situated 6.6 miles east of Frenchtown.
